Default electric windows

help !!

the electric windows dont work in my escort.

theres power at the fuse box

theres power at the switches

both the motors work if i put power straight to them

checked the fuse

changed the relay

with out pulling the hole loom out im baffled.

anybody got any ideas. or a wiring diagram.

ive been out with a volt meter.

there is constant power at the switch black/yellow wire 12.5 volts with ignition on.

the wires that go to the motor blue and green

blue is up, green is down or the other way, cant remember

if i put a volt meter on either blue or green and press switch i only get 0.30 volts.

what does this mean.

As I say you need to check other side of switch with it closed to see what power you are getting there, if it mirrors your said 0.30V then will be dead switch. Could bridge the connection as a test as well.

turned out to be the switches. mate came round with his orion tryed 1 of his, hey presto worked.
